With orals for sure especially at the start when your body still isn't used to "process" them efficiently, but it shouldn't last more than a few days. Unless they make your BP increase too much (anadrol comes to mind), and those nauseous feelings are heart related... thus only disappear once you stop said compound.

Stims like heavily dosed caffeine pre-workouts (or your own blend of several ones mixed together), on the other hand, are an instantaneous cause of discomfort if taken in too large quantity... so many times have I felt like puking or on the verge of having a heart attack after over dosing them... :eek: "Legal" definitely doesn't mean harmless, so better be careful with what and above all how much you're taking. :eek:
 
I've had similar issues off and on, and here is what has worked for me at least.

One, I take omeprazole every day regardless of whether or not I feel the need for it. Whenever I go a few days without the first thing that starts happening is the nausea followed shortly by indigestion and then throwing up bile.

Two, a big focus on making sure I get quality fiber in my diet and also pro biotic foods. Kefir is my preference just because I like the taste, but sauerkraut is a close second for me.

Three, after getting a bunch of tests run just recently, I discovered some previously unknown food allergies that were contributing to my issues. More specifically, avocado of all things. So it might be of benefit (if you haven't done so already) to get some food allergy tests done as a lot of times they don't hit people until later in life.

I also have a script for nausea medication for the odd times things are real bad, so might be worth talking to your doctor about getting some just to have on hand as well. Best of luck to you man, hopefully you can get it figured out before it makes life to miserable!

Aren't you scared that PPI's like omeprazole taken LONG TERM cause an increased risk for infection due to them increasing your gastric PH by reducing gastric acid secretions, which naturally help your body fight bad bacterias?

Not to mention the malabsorption of nutrients, mainly minerals like calcium or magnesium...

PPI's can be extremely useful, but I'd be cautious using them on a daily basis... :cool:
 
It is definitely a concern I've had and discussed with my doctor, but from what was explained to me, my body is constantly over producing gastric acids so taking the omeprazole is basically bringing me to baseline. I started having these problems in my early teens and there's a family history as well (gall bladder issues, kidney stones, acid reflux), so I don't know how accurate the statement is by my doctor, but I can say I rarely ever actually get sick thankfully.

I would like to eventually not need to use a PPI though, and I'm hoping that the previously undiagnosed food allergies are the root cause of my problem. I'm going to slowly start decreasing the frequency I take omeprazole and see how it goes.

PPI caused terrible adductor muscle cramps for me

Thought I would mention the horrific cramps I had in my inner thigh over 3 different nights after taking a PPI over 4 weeks. I had to drop it and go to pepcid instead. I've had no more of those cramps.
